Building raising services involve elevating existing structures to a higher level, typically to protect against flooding, water damage, or other environmental concerns. The process usually includes lifting the building from its foundation and then constructing a new, stable base beneath it. Skilled contractors use specialized equipment and techniques to ensure the building is safely and accurately raised, minimizing disruption to the existing structure. This service is often chosen as a solution to adapt properties for changing environmental conditions or to comply with local floodplain management regulations.

These services address several common problems faced by property owners, especially in flood-prone areas. Rising water levels can threaten the integrity of a building, leading to costly damages and the need for extensive repairs. Building raising offers a proactive way to mitigate these risks by elevating the structure above potential flood levels. Additionally, raising a building can help preserve historical or valuable properties that would otherwise be difficult or costly to replace or relocate. It also provides an opportunity to upgrade foundations or improve the overall stability of the property.

Typically, building raising services are utilized for residential properties, particularly single-family homes situated in flood zones or low-lying areas. Commercial buildings, including small businesses and historic structures, may also benefit from this process when flood risks threaten their operation or preservation. Properties that have experienced previous flood damage or are located in areas with seasonal water level fluctuations are common candidates. The service is especially relevant for properties where relocating is impractical or undesirable, making elevation the most effective solution.

The overview below groups typical Building Raising proj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Saint Clair Shores, MI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Foundation Assessment - Costs for evaluating existing foundations typically range from $300 to $1,000, depending on the property size and complexity. This assessment helps determine the scope of the raising project and potential challenges.

Raising Equipment and Materials - The price for lifting and supporting structures generally falls between $10,000 and $30,000. Factors influencing costs include the home's size, height, and foundation type, with larger homes costing more.

Permits and Inspection Fees - Permit costs vary widely by location but usually range from $500 to $2,000. Additional inspection fees may apply, depending on local regulations and project scope.

Additional Repairs and Reinforcements - Expenses for foundation repairs, underpinning, or reinforcement can add $5,000 to $15,000 or more. These costs depend on the extent of existing issues and the structural requirements identified by local pros.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
